The three platforms at a glance
All three connect your apps and automate workflows, but they’re built for different users and scale very differently.
- Zapier — the market’s most popular automation tool, known for the widest app catalog and the gentlest learning curve. Zapier says it connects 9,000+ apps, and its current platform pricing is task-based across Zap workflows, AI steps, code, MCP, and SDK usage.
- Make — a visual, canvas-based builder for multi-branch “scenarios.” Make describes usage as credits: each module action in a scenario, such as adding a Google Sheets row or fetching Gmail data, counts as one credit. Its pricing page lists 3,000+ standard apps.
- n8n — open-source and self-hostable (also offered as managed cloud). n8n pricing is based on monthly workflow executions with unlimited steps, and its docs include advanced AI workflows, LangChain-style components, and agent/vector-store patterns for teams building beyond simple app-to-app automations.
How each one charges — and why it decides your bill
This is the part most comparisons get wrong. The platform you can afford at 1,000 runs/month may be unaffordable at 100,000.
- Zapier (per task): Zapier says every step in a Zap and every external connector call uses tasks, though rates can vary by AI model tier, code runtime, and connector type. Simple, but costs climb as workflows get multi-step and high-volume.
- Make (per credit): Make now frames usage as credits: each module action in a scenario counts as one credit. That makes it important to model every router, filter, API call, and data step before assuming a scenario is cheap at scale.
- n8n (per execution / self-hosted): managed n8n bills by workflow execution with unlimited steps. Self-hosted n8n lets you run the standard Community edition on your own infrastructure, so your economics depend more on hosting and maintenance than per-step metering.
Takeaway: map your real monthly volume and average steps-per-workflow before you pick. The cheapest tool at low volume is rarely the cheapest at scale.
n8n vs Zapier vs Make: the comparison
| Zapier | Make | n8n | |
|---|---|---|---|
| Best for | Non-technical teams, simple workflows | Visual power users, complex scenarios | Developers, high volume, full control |
| Ease of use | Easiest | Moderate (visual canvas) | Moderate–technical |
| Pricing model | Per task | Per operation | Per execution / self-hosted |
| App ecosystem | Largest | Large | Large + custom/code nodes |
| Complex logic | Limited | Strong | Strong |
| Self-hosting | No | No | Yes |
| AI / agent nodes | Growing | Growing | Native + extensible |
| Cost at scale | Highest | Moderate | Lowest (self-hosted) |
All feature/pricing specifics verified at time of publish; platforms change frequently.
How AI changed the automation question
Through 2024–2026, all three platforms pushed deeper into AI. Zapier now positions itself around AI orchestration, Tables, Forms, MCP, Agents, and Chatbots. Make has AI apps, AI Agents, MCP Server, and AI Toolkit features. n8n stands out for technical teams because its docs expose AI workflows, LangChain-style nodes, memory, tools, and vector-store patterns inside the workflow builder.
If your roadmap includes AI agents that take actions (not just summarize text), platform choice matters more than ever — and it’s where most DIY builds stall.
When to DIY vs buy vs hire
Tooling is only half the decision. The other half is who builds and maintains it.
- DIY makes sense when workflows are few, simple, and low-stakes — a marketer wiring a form to a CRM in Zapier. Start here; don’t over-engineer.
- Buy (a higher tier / managed cloud) makes sense when you’ve outgrown the free plan but the logic is still standard. Pay to remove limits, not to solve complexity.
- Hire / partner makes sense when automations become business-critical, span many systems, handle real volume, or involve AI agents and error handling. At that point a broken Zap isn’t an annoyance — it’s lost revenue, and the cost of getting it wrong exceeds the cost of building it right.
The honest signal you’ve crossed the line: you’re spending more time fixing and babysitting automations than the automations save you.
Common mistakes when choosing
- Optimizing for today’s volume. You pick the easy tool, then get a painful bill (or a rebuild) at scale.
- Confusing “most apps” with “best fit.” The widest catalog doesn’t help if your real need is complex logic or AI orchestration.
- Ignoring error handling. A workflow with no retries, alerts, or logging will fail silently and quietly cost you.
- Treating automation as set-and-forget. APIs change; workflows need ownership and monitoring.

Frequently asked questions
Is n8n really cheaper than Zapier?
At scale, usually yes — especially self-hosted, because you avoid per-task billing. At low volume the difference is small and Zapier’s ease may be worth more than the savings.
Is n8n hard to use compared to Zapier?
It’s more technical. Zapier is the easiest to start; n8n rewards a bit more setup with far more power and control.
Which is best for AI agents?
All three now have AI features. For technical agentic workflows, n8n is usually the most flexible because its AI nodes, code steps, self-hosting path, and developer-oriented workflow model make it easier to combine LLMs, tools, memory, APIs, and custom logic.
Can I switch platforms later?
Yes, but workflows don’t port automatically — you rebuild them. Choosing for your projected volume up front avoids an expensive migration.
Do I need a developer?
For simple Zaps, no. For complex, high-volume, or AI-driven automation, technical ownership (in-house or a partner) prevents costly silent failures.
